Engine Performance Challenges

Many car owners experience motor efficiency issues that can affect safety and efficiency significantly. Common issues include weak acceleration, rough idling, and decreased fuel economy, often stemming from causes like defective spark plugs, clogged fuel filters, or faulty sensors. Motor misfires can suggest more serious issues, requiring prompt diagnosis to prevent further damage. Routine upkeep, such as oil changes and air filter changes, plays an important role in preventing these issues. Furthermore, paying attention for unusual noises and observing dashboard warning lights can assist in early detection. Addressing engine performance problems swiftly not only enhances vehicle safety but also extends the life of the engine, ensuring reliable operation for years to come. Prompt expert evaluation is crucial for effective resolution.

Brake System Malfunctions

Engine operation issues can often be accompanied by concerns related to the brake system, which is vital for vehicle safety. Common brake system problems include squeaking or grinding noises, reduced stopping ability, and the presence of warning lights on the dashboard. These issues may point to deteriorated brake pads, damaged rotors, or low brake fluid levels. Regular inspections can help identify these problems early, preventing further harm and ensuring peak performance. When addressing brake issues, it is important to consult a experienced technician who can diagnose the problem accurately and recommend suitable solutions. Timely maintenance not only enhance safety but also prolong the lifespan of the braking system, ensuring reliable vehicle operation on the road.

Electrical System Breakdowns

Electrical system failures can interrupt a vehicle's operation and jeopardize safety. Typical problems consist of battery issues, faulty alternators, and damaged wiring harnesses. A dead battery often stems from age or excessive drain, causing starting difficulties. Alternators, in charge of charging the battery, can fail, causing electrical components to malfunction. Additionally, frayed or corroded wiring can create shorts or intermittent issues, affecting everything from headlights to dashboard indicators. Diagnosing these problems typically requires specialized equipment and expertise. Regular inspections can help identify potential failures before they escalate. When issues arise, seeking professional auto repair services guarantees that electrical systems are efficiently restored, maintaining both vehicle functionality and driver safety. Prompt attention to electrical failures can save time and costly repairs in the long run.

Essential Upkeep Tips to Prevent Common Auto Repairs

Regular upkeep is crucial in preventing typical vehicle repairs, as it allows car owners to identify possible problems before they escalate. Regular inspections of fluids, such as oil, coolant, and brake fluid, help ensure the vehicle runs properly. Tire pressure should be monitored regularly, with rotations and alignments performed as required to extend tire life and improve safety.

In addition, brake inspections are important; worn pads can bring about considerable damage if not addressed right away. Replacing air filter units and windshield wipers at prescribed intervals can better performance and visibility.

Scheduling regular maintenance visits with a reliable mechanic also provides an opportunity for comprehensive examinations. By following these important care guidelines, vehicle owners can reduce the likelihood of unexpected breakdowns and expensive maintenance, eventually prolonging the lifespan of their automobiles and enhancing their driving experience.
